Clinicopathological characteristics and postoperative prognosis of patients with nuclear pedigree of esophageal squamous cell carcinoma. Front Oncol 2023; 13:1190457. Abstract
The aim of this work is to analyze the clinicopathological characteristics and prognostic factors of patients with nuclear pedigree of esophageal cancer. The clinicopathological data and follow-up information of 3,260 patients from different nuclear pedigree of esophageal cancer who underwent radical resection of esophageal cancer were collected, and the clinicopathological characteristics and prognostic factors of the patients were analyzed. The male to female ratio of 3,260 patients with esophageal cancer was 1.7:1. The diagnosis age was ranged from 32 to 85 (60.2 ± 8.1) years old. About 53.8% of the patients were ≥ 60 years old; About 88.8% of the patients came from the high incidence area of esophageal cancer; About 82.5% of the tumors were located in the middle and lower segments of esophagus; Poor, moderate and well differentiation accounted for 26.6%, 61.9% and 11.5% respectively; The surgical margin accounted for 94.3%; 47.6% of the tumors were shorter than 4 cm in length; Clinicopathological TNM stage (0+I) accounted for 15.2%, and stage II, III and IV accounted for 54.5%, 29.9% and 0.4%, respectively. Cox analysis showed that male, diagnosed age ≥ 60 years, tumor located in neck and upper esophageal segments, poor differentiation, tumor length ≥ 4 cm, and advanced TNM were independent risk factors for the prognosis of patients in nuclear pedigree with esophageal cancer. Gender, diagnosis age, tumor location, degree of differentiation, tumor length and TNM stage are the influencing factors for the prognosis of patients with nuclear pedigree of esophageal cancer, which will provide important data for the future study of esophageal cancer family aggregation.

Yang X, Zhai Y, Bi N, Zhang T, Deng L, Wang W, Wang X, Chen D, Zhou Z, Wang L, Liang J. Radiotherapy combined with nimotuzumab for elderly esophageal cancer patients: A phase II clinical trial. Abstract
Objective To investigate the safety and efficacy of nimotuzumab combined with radiotherapy for elderly patients with non-resectable esophageal carcinoma (EC). Methods Eligible patients were aged 70 years or older and had treatment-naïve, histologically proven inoperable locally advanced EC. Enrolled patients received radiotherapy with a total dose of 50−60 Gy in 25−30 fractions, concurrent with weekly infusion of nimotuzumab. The primary end point was the rate of more than grade 3 toxicities. Results From June 2011 to July 2016, 46 patients with stage II−IV EC with a median age of 76.5 years were enrolled. There were 10, 28 and 8 patients with stage II, III and IV disease, respectively. The common acute toxicities included esophagitis (grade 1−2, 75.4%; grade 3, 8.7%), pneumonitis (grade 1, 4.3%; grade 2, 6.5%; grade 3, 2.2%), leukopenia (grade 1−2, 60.9%; grade 3−4, 4.4%), gastrointestinal reaction (grade 1−2, 17.3%; grade 3, 2.2%), thrombocytopenia (grade 1−2, 21.7%; grade 3, 2.2%), and radiothermitis (grade 1−2, 39.2%). The incidence of grade 3−4 adverse effects was 17.4%. No grade 5 toxicities were observed. Clinical complete response, partial response, stable disease, and progressive disease were observed in 1 (2.2%), 31 (67.4%), 12 (26.1%), and 2 (4.3%) patients, respectively. The median overall survival (OS) and progression-free survival (PFS) were 17 and 10 months, respectively. The 2-, 3-, and 5-year OS and PFS rates were 30.4%, 21.7%, 19.6%, and 26.1%, 19.6%, 19.6%, respectively. Conclusions Nimotuzumab combined with radiotherapy is a safe and effective therapy for elderly patients who are not surgical candidates. Further studies are warranted to confirm its therapeutic effects in elderly EC patients.

Advanced Age is Not a Contraindication for Treatment With Curative Intent in Esophageal Cancer. Am J Clin Oncol 2019; 41:919-926. Abstract
OBJECTIVES The objective of this study is to compare long-term outcomes between younger and older (70 y and above) esophageal cancer patients treated with curative intent. MATERIALS AND METHODS Overall survival (OS), disease-free survival (DFS), and locoregional recurrence-free interval were compared between older (70 y and above) and younger (below 70 y) esophageal cancer patients treated between 1998 and 2013. Treatment consisted of neoadjuvant chemoradiotherapy with surgery or definitive chemoradiotherapy: 36 to 50.4 Gy in 18 to 28 fractions combined with 5-fluorouracil/cisplatin or carboplatin/paclitaxel. RESULTS The study comprised 253 patients, of whom 76 were 70 years and older. Median age was 64 years (range, 41 to 83). Most patients had stage II-IIIA disease (83%). Planned treatment was neoadjuvant chemoradiotherapy with surgery for 169 patients (41 patients aged 70 y and older) and definitive chemoradiotherapy for 84 patients (31 patients aged 70 y and older). The compliance to radiotherapy was 92%, with no difference between older and younger patients. In 33 patients (13 patients aged 70 y and older) planned surgery was not performed. Median follow-up was 4.9 years. Three-year OS was 42%. The multivariable analysis showed no statistical difference in OS or in DFS comparing older and younger patients: OS (hazard ratio [HR], 0.88; 95% confidence interval [CI], 0.61-1.28), DFS (HR, 0.87; 95% CI, 0.60-1.25). Elderly showed a longer locoregional recurrence-free interval; HR, 0.53 (95% CI, 0.30-0.92; P=0.02) and a higher pathologic complete response rate (50% vs. 25%; P=0.02). CONCLUSIONS Long-term outcomes of older esophageal cancer patients (70 y and above) selected for treatment with neoadjuvant chemoradiotherapy followed by surgery or definitive chemoradiotherapy were comparable with the outcomes of their younger counterparts. Advanced age alone should not be a contraindication for potentially curative chemoradiotherapy-based treatment in esophageal cancer patients.
